HS400 requires a data strobe line in addition to the usual MMC signal
lines. If a board design neglects to wire up this signal, HS400 mode is
not available, even if both the controller and the eMMC are claiming to
support this mode. Add a DT flag to allow boards to disable the HS400
support in this case.

The commit 7c7905df68c5 ("dt-bindings: mmc: sdhci-am654: fix compatible
for j7200") switched the compatible property from a regular enum to an
more appropriate combinatorial oneOf convention, and in the process has
introduced a duplicate ti,j721e-sdhci-4bit.
This generated the following warning on J721E boards that use the
ti,j721e-sdhci-4bit for two nodes:
"mmc@4fb0000: compatible: More than one condition true in oneOf schema"
"mmc@4f98000: compatible: More than one condition true in oneOf schema"
Remove the duplicate to fix this.

Qualcomm WCD9380/WCD9385 Codec is a standalone Hi-Fi audio codec IC
connected over SoundWire. This device has two SoundWire devices RX and
TX respectively. This bindings is for those slave devices on WCD9380/WCD9385.

BMA254 is very similar to BMA253/BMA255 which are both supported by
the bmc150-accel driver. In general, there is quite some overlap between
the bma180 and bmc150-accel driver, but the bmc150-accel driver has a few
more features (e.g. motion trigger/interrupt).
Let's move bma254 over to the bma255 schema (bmc150-accel driver).

BMA253 has two interrupt pins (INT1 and INT2) that can be configured
independently. At the moment the bmc150-accel driver does not make use
of them but it might be able to in the future, so it's useful to already
specify all available interrupts in the device tree.
Set maxItems: 2 for interrupts to allow specifying a second one.
This is necessary as preparation to move the bosch,bma254 compatible
from bosch,bma180.yaml to bosch,bma255.yaml since bma180 allows two
interrupts, but BMA254 is better supported by the bmc150-accel driver.
